Home    Blog    Entertainment    Links    RSS     Disclosure

Thursday, April 1, 2010

Erykah Badu Controversial "Window Seat" Music Video

This is the controversial music video of Erykah Badu where she strips at the Dallas's Dealey Plaza, the same spot where John F. Kennedy was assassinated.

If you like this post, buy me a cup of coffee.

No comments: